Understanding Sheet Metal Forming Machines An Overview


Sheet metal forming is a critical process in various industries, including automotive, aerospace, and manufacturing. The ability to mold and shape metal sheets into desired forms is essential for producing components that meet stringent specifications. At the heart of this process lies sheet metal forming machines, which are designed to enhance efficiency, precision, and productivity.


Sheet metal forming machines come in numerous types, each tailored to specific applications and materials. Common types include hydraulic presses, mechanical presses, and CNC (Computer Numerical Control) laser cutting machines. Hydraulic presses utilize fluid pressure to shape metal, offering high force application and flexibility in operation. This makes them ideal for deep drawing and complex shapes. Mechanical presses, on the other hand, employ a toggle or crank mechanism to provide rapid stroke and high precision, making them suitable for high-volume production of simple parts.


CNC laser cutting machines represent a more advanced technology, allowing for precise cutting and etching of metal sheets with minimal wastage. These machines use a focused laser beam to melt or vaporize the material, producing clean edges and intricate designs. The automation aspect of CNC technology enhances repeatability and reduces labor costs, making it a preferred choice for many manufacturers.


One of the key advantages of using sheet metal forming machines is their ability to produce parts with consistent quality and precision. This is particularly important in industries where tolerances are critical, such as in the production of automotive components, where even a slight deviation can lead to severe performance issues. By utilizing advanced machines, manufacturers can achieve high repeatability and lower defect rates, ultimately contributing to improved product reliability.

Another benefit is the reduction in material waste. Traditional methods of metal shaping often resulted in significant scrap material. However, modern sheet metal forming machines are designed to maximize the use of raw materials, reducing waste and lowering production costs. Techniques such as nesting in CNC laser cutting optimize the layout of parts on the metal sheet, ensuring that as much material as possible is utilized.


Moreover, advancements in technology have driven the development of hybrid machines that combine different forming techniques. For instance, some machines may incorporate both laser cutting and bending capabilities, allowing for a more streamlined workflow. This integration reduces the number of separate processing steps and contributes to faster lead times for product delivery.


As industries continue to evolve, so do the requirements for sheet metal forming machines. Manufacturers are increasingly seeking machines that can adapt to varying material types, thicknesses, and complex geometries. Innovations in automation, artificial intelligence, and IoT (Internet of Things) integration are paving the way for smarter machines that can monitor processes in real-time, adjust settings dynamically, and predict maintenance needs to minimize downtime.
